It is with a heavy heart that the Owusu and Koranteng- Asante families announce the death of their son, brother, father and loved one, Jerry Kwame Owusu (aka Jerry Booze).
He passed on to glory on Wednesday the 18th of March 2020.
We appreciate the outpouring of love shown to those he left behind and are most grateful.
We would like to inform all that in light of the ban on public gathering as announced by the President of Ghana due to the unprecedented health scare of COVID-19 (coronavirus) there will be no observance of the (1) one week of his passing.
All plans have been suspended until such time as it is safe to plan his funeral and give him a befitting send-off.
Thank you, stay safe and God bless.
